AVI to MP3 uses FFmpeg's default encoding profile for MP3 — a well-balanced trade-off between quality and size. For lossless quality, prefer targets like WAV, FLAC, or lossless-WebM.
Roughly 30-60 seconds per minute of source video on a modern laptop. The first use of AVI to MP3 also downloads FFmpeg's WebAssembly core (~30 MB) — that download is cached forever afterwards.
